Complement C5a, des-Arginine

More information in Books or onNLM PubMed
Definition: A derivative of complement C5a, generated when the carboxy-terminal ARGININE is removed by CARBOXYPEPTIDASE B present in normal human serum. C5a des-Arg shows complete loss of spasmogenic activity though it retains some chemotactic ability (CHEMOATTRACTANTS).     
Pharmacological Action Immunologic Factors
